Will Cost of Arthritis Drugs Soon Be More than Medicare, Senior Citizens Can Afford? (Senior Journal)
June 2, 2009 Certain drugs that are effective at reducing symptoms and slowing progression of rheumatoid arthritis (RA), a common condition for senior citizens, are so expensive they are putting pressure on Medicare Part D plans and beneficiaries.

HHS Releases $30 Million to Help Medicare Beneficiaries Access Their Benefits (Business Wire via Yahoo! Finance)
WASHINGTON----HHS Secretary Kathleen Sebelius today released $25 million in grants to help older people, individuals with disabilities and their caregivers apply for special assistance through Medicare, and an additional $5 million for a national resource center to support these important efforts.
